    Quote Originally Posted by tbrum View Post
    Hey Brian. I've never seen them sold here. But I don't get out much. You can just order direct from Foam Factory.

    That being said, a hot knife won't work on a CompARF... it works on soft foam like polystyrene, Depron, EPP, etc

    Quote Originally Posted by BAMDFISHER View Post

    Trevor on the RC Universe site, in the Spitfire building forum, a fellow used a Hot Knife to cut all of his hatches on the SPIT.

    The job looked great. The knife looked like this.
    Ah. That tool looks more like a soldering gun with a different tip. I can see how that would cut through a CompARF. But these Foam Factory Hot Knives are not heavy duty like that. Two completely different tools.
